I'd like to ask/suggest something:

In the previous UI (4.2?), when you entered the VM snapshots page, you
saw per each snapshot some details that you do not see in the current
UI. Specifically, to see the creation date, you have to press General.
So I got used to writing longer descriptions, with the creation date
in them, but that also does not work well, because in the main view
only the start of the description is shown. At least for me
(combination of browser, OS, etc.), there is a lot of white unused
space between the end of the presented-part of the description, and
the "> General" after it. Can we somehow use this space to either add
the creation date, or more/all of the description, or even make this
customizable? And perhaps make this a sortable table (so that you can
sort by description, or if you added Data, you can sort by that, or
memory, or whatever)? I don't mind opening a bug/RFE for this, if more
people agree that it's useful, and unless there are some (unknown to
me) reasons against that (other than the time needed for implementing
this, which I expect is quite minimal for the simplest option of just
showing more of the description).
